Handover note — Crumbwheel order cutoffs.

Welcome aboard. The bakery cutoff rule in Crumbwheel closes same-day orders at 14:00 local to each storefront, not UTC — this has bitten us twice. Holiday overrides live in the calendar service and take precedence silently, so always check there first when a cutoff looks wrong. To unlock the calendar service's admin console after a restart, enter the recovery passphrase below.

vault phrase of bagap-bahaf = silion-pelox-sorox-casdor-quenwyn-fraax-eliox-praael-kelion-quenvan-kasox-rusael-norius-belvan

Migration Step 4: Enable Offline Mode (Fernhollow Surveyor)

Upgrade clients to 3.2 before flipping the flag. Offline capture queues survey entries locally and syncs when connectivity returns; conflict resolution is last-write-wins per field. Purge stale local caches first or sync will reject mixed-schema batches. Roll out region by region. Apply the following configuration to each deployment.

deployment values, hawep-hawep:
RALAX_PIN=0900
RALAX_TENANT=sildor
RALAX_METRICS_HOST=metrics.ralax.xolmardata.example
RALAX_SEAL=seal_87e42d77
RALAX_STANDBY_TEAM=briius

# Training Budget — Next Year (Managers Only)

Quick rundown for the finance crew at Pellastra Logistics. We're proposing a 15% bump to the training pot, mostly for the new Wayfinder certification track and refreshed safety modules at the Corbin Heath depot. External facilitators eat about a third; the rest is backfill cover and materials. Yes, it looks chunky, but attrition costs from last year make the case on their own. Draft numbers live in the planning workbook. The confidential business context sits just below.

internal memo for taguf-kafop: Novmirax Group plans to lower the Oliius list price by 42.0 percent in March. The board signed off on a budget of $367.8 million for Project Belael. The renewal with Drumirax Logistics closes at $302.4 million a year, 54.0 percent below the last contract. Project Kelys slips by a full year because of the staffing delay.

Facilities Ticket — Cleaning Crew Access, Brindle Annex

For new starters handling evening lock-up: the Sorano Cleaning crew arrives nightly at 21:30 via the annex side door. Check their rota sheet, note arrival in the log, and ensure the storeroom is relocked afterward. To let them through the side door, enter the access code below.

badge for yaweg-hafog: bdg-GX-6